Less Invasive Ultrasonography-Guided High Ligation of Great Saphenous Vein in Endovenous Laser Ablation

Abstract

Endovenous laser ablation (EVLA) has two pitfalls: endovenous heat-induced thrombosis (EHIT) and great saphenous vein (GSV) recanalization. To eliminate these complications, we developed ultrasonography-guided high ligation (UGHL) using a puncture-sized incision as an adjunct treatment to EVLA. UGHL combined with EVLA was used in 20 patients. The GSV was encircled with 2-0 silk thread at 2 cm distal to the saphenofemoral junction through two incisions of 2–3 mm by using a Deschamps aneurysm needle under ultrasonographic guidance.
UGHL was technically feasible in all cases, and no case presented with complications. UGHL may be used in addition to EVLA.
